Understanding the request for proposal (RFP)
A Request for Proposal (RFP) is a formal document soliciting proposals from vendors or service providers, details the requirements and scope of a project, and sets the framework for evaluating potential solutions. Issuing an RFP is crucial in many industries, as it helps ensure that organizations receive competitive bids and select the best option for their needs.
Organizations may choose to issue an RFP with no pre-set form when they anticipate diverse responses or if the project is unique in nature. This flexibility can lead to more innovative solutions, as vendors are not restricted by a standardized format.

Writing RFP questions
Questions included in RFPs are vital for eliciting the necessary information from potential vendors. It's crucial to frame these questions clearly and concisely to avoid confusion.
Examples of effective questions might include inquiries about previous projects, projected timelines, and methodologies used.
